# Break-Glass: Catalog Cache Invalidation

Scope: the Pinrow product catalog at Veldstone Retail. If stale prices persist after a purge and the Hollowmere invalidation queue is wedged, use break-glass to flush the edge tier directly. Contractors: get verbal sign-off from the catalog lead first. Steps: open the Hollowmere admin shell, select emergency-flush, confirm the tenant, and run it once — repeated flushes thrash the origin. Access is logged and expires after 20 minutes. Unseal the admin shell with the passphrase below.

recovery phrase for kahop-tajog: istix-casvan

MEMO — Customer Concentration Risk

To: Incoming Director, Commercial Division

Welcome aboard. One item needs your early attention: Quillford Systems accounts for 38% of annual revenue, and their contract renews in five months. Our diversification efforts in the Fennridge market are behind plan. A dedicated task group meets weekly; you will chair it from next Monday. The agreed direction is set out in the confidential note below.

board note of kageg-bahof: The renewal with Holwynax Holdings closes at $2 million a year, 5 percent below the last contract. Project Ulaath slips by two quarters because of the supplier delay.

### Account Recovery — Catalogue Import (Lintwood)

Quick one for review: when the Lintwood catalogue import wipes a patron's session table, the recovery flow re-seeds accounts from the nightly snapshot. Check that the importer skips locked accounts — last time it didn't. To rerun recovery against staging you'll need the vault passphrase, which is appended just below.

recovery phrase for yafof-tajof: julmir-kelax-julvan-holath-belvan-holir-ralael-ralvan-ralath-julvan-silmir-istmir-kaswyn-ulamir

Subject: DR drill — Spoolwright spooler service

Plugin authors: on Thursday we run a disaster-recovery drill for the Spoolwright printer-spooler microservice. Expect the sandbox queue endpoint to be offline for two hours while we restore from snapshot. Your plugins should retry with backoff. To re-register test plugins after the failover, use the recovery passphrase below.

recovery phrase for fahif-hadup: sorix-holael